이 워크플로에서는 vSphere IaaS control plane를 이미 사용하도록 설정하고, 감독자를 설정했으며, 이제 vSphere 네임스페이스를 생성하여 워크로드에 사용할 준비가 되었다고 가정합니다.

사용자 역할

일반적으로 감독자와 상호 작용하고 워크로드를 실행하려면 두 가지 역할(vSphere 관리자 및 DevOps 엔지니어)이 필요합니다. vSphere 관리자 및 DevOps 엔지니어 역할에 대한 워크플로는 고유하며 이러한 역할에 필요한 특정 전문 기술 영역에 따라 결정됩니다.

vSphere 관리자
vSphere 관리자는 일반적으로 vSphere Client를 사용하여 감독자 및 네임스페이스를 구성하며 여기에서 DevOps 엔지니어가 Kubernetes 워크로드를 배포할 수 있습니다.

감독자를 생성하지 않았고 생성 방법에 대해 알아보려면 vSphere IaaS 제어부 설치 및 구성을 참조하십시오.

DevOps 엔지니어
감독자에서 DevOps 엔지니어의 역할은 일반적으로 Kubernetes 개발자, 애플리케이션 소유자 및 Kubernetes 관리자가 수행하는 작업을 결합할 수 있습니다. DevOps 엔지니어는 kubectl 명령을 사용합니다. vSphere 관리자가 생성해준 감독자 네임스페이스에서 vSphere 포드, VM 및 기타 워크로드를 배포하고 실행할 수 있습니다. 셀프 서비스 네임스페이스를 생성할 수도 있습니다.

이 "vSphere IaaS 제어부 서비스 및 워크로드" 가이드는 DevOps 엔지니어가 Tanzu Kubernetes Grid 클러스터에서 수행하는 작업을 다루지 않기 때문에 이러한 작업에 대해 알아보려면 vSphere IaaS 제어부를 사용하여 감독자에서 Tanzu Kubernetes Grid 사용을 참조하십시오.

감독자가 지원하는 워크로드 유형

다양한 유형의 워크로드에 대한 감독자 지원은 감독자가 사용하는 구성 및 네트워킹에 따라 다릅니다.
워크로드 유형 VDS 네트워킹을 사용하는 1개 영역 감독자 NSX 네트워킹을 사용하는 1개 영역 감독자 VDS 네트워킹을 사용하는 3개 영역 감독자 NSX 네트워킹을 사용하는 3개 영역 감독자
vSphere 포드 아니요 아니요 아니요
VM 서비스를 사용하여 프로비저닝된 VM
감독자 서비스 아니요 아니요
Tanzu Kubernetes Grid 클러스터

네임스페이스를 구성하는 워크플로

vSphere 관리자는 감독자에서 vSphere 네임스페이스를 생성하고 관리할 수 있습니다. Tanzu Kubernetes Grid개 클러스터

네임스페이스를 생성하기 전에 DevOps 엔지니어가 실행하려는 애플리케이션 및 워크로드에 대한 특정 리소스 요구 사항을 수집해야 합니다. 이러한 규격을 기반으로 적절한 리소스를 구성하여 네임스페이스에 할당할 수 있습니다.

자세한 내용은 vSphere 네임스페이스 구성 및 관리의 내용을 참조하십시오.
그림 1. 네임스페이스를 구성하는 워크플로

이 다이어그램은 vSphere 네임스페이스를 구성하는 워크플로를 보여줍니다.

셀프 서비스 네임스페이스를 구성하는 워크플로

vSphere 관리자는 vSphere 네임스페이스를 생성하고, CPU, 메모리 및 스토리지 제한을 네임스페이스에 설정하고, 사용 권한을 할당하고, 클러스터에서 네임스페이스 서비스를 템플릿으로 프로비저닝 또는 활성화할 수 있습니다. 자세한 내용은 vSphere IaaS control plane에서 셀프 서비스 네임스페이스 템플릿 프로비저닝의 내용을 참조하십시오.
그림 2. 셀프 서비스 네임스페이스에 대한 vSphere 관리자 워크플로
이 다이어그램은 셀프 서비스 네임스페이스 템플릿을 사용하도록 설정하기 위한 워크플로를 보여줍니다.
DevOps 엔지니어는 셀프 서비스 방식으로 vSphere 네임스페이스를 생성하고 그 안에 워크로드를 배포할 수 있습니다. 다른 DevOps 엔지니어와 공유하거나 더 이상 필요하지 않으면 삭제할 수 있습니다.
그림 3. 셀프 서비스 네임스페이스에 대한 DevOps 워크플로
이 다이어그램은 셀프 서비스 네임스페이스를 생성하는 워크플로를 보여줍니다.

vSphere 포드 및 VM을 프로비저닝하는 워크플로

DevOps 엔지니어는 감독자에서 실행 중인 네임스페이스의 리소스 경계 내에서 vSphere 포드 및 VM을 배포할 수 있습니다.

자세한 내용은 vSphere 포드에 워크로드 배포vSphere IaaS control plane에서 가상 시스템 배포 및 관리 항목을 참조하십시오.

그림 4. vSphere 포드 및 VM 프로비저닝 워크플로

이 다이어그램은 vSphere 포드 및 VM을 프로비저닝하는 워크플로를 보여줍니다.